A not-for-profit group that works to ensure everyone has access to safe and affordable housing has a festive fundraiser in the works, and it promises to be an elegant affair.
The guests at Habitat for Humanity’s Nashua Home for the Holidays cocktail party will be enjoying a special experience on offer at the Nashua Center for the Arts. The emcee for the event will be Mike Morin, who is a local radio personality and author, and tickets are $75 each.
The function will see its guests sample an assortment of light bites, and cocktails will be poured as well. The crowd can mix and mingle, and anyone who would like to help but cannot make it in person is encouraged to make a monetary donation.
Along with the cocktails and food, the function will boast a silent auction. The attendees can bid on the donated Corporate Gifts, experiences, and other items up for bids. The event will allow shoppers to pick up some special holiday gifts while ensuring everyone in the community has access to affordable housing.
The Home for the Holidays fundraiser for Habitat for Humanity will be opening the holiday season in high style on Friday, December 1. Its doors will open to the guests at 5:30 pm, and tickets may be reserved through its Patch listing.
